As part of a thorough assessment, the newborn should be checked for hip dislocation and dysplasia. Which of the following techniques would be used?

a. Check for syndactyly bilaterally
b. Stepping or walking reflex
c. Magnet reflex
d. Ortolani's maneuver

Final answer:

The newborn should be checked for hip dislocation and dysplasia using Ortolani's maneuver.

Step-by-step explanation:

To check for hip dislocation and dysplasia in newborns, the technique that would be used is Ortolani's maneuver. This technique involves manually moving the hips in order to feel for any clicking or clunking sensations, which could indicate a problem with the hip joint.
